5 Instant Design Tricks to Overcome Creative Blocks
Feeling stuck in your creative process can be frustrating, but with the right design tricks, overcoming these blocks can be a breeze. Here are five instant design tricks that can help reignite your creativity:
- Change Your Environment: Sometimes, a change of scenery is all you need. Whether it’s rearranging your workspace or heading to a café, a new environment can spark fresh ideas.
- Use Visual Inspiration: Surround yourself with inspiring visuals. Create a mood board with images, colors, and patterns that resonate with your vision. This visual stimulus can pave the way for new thoughts.
3. Break the Rules: Don’t be afraid to experiment. Allow yourself to break design rules and try something unconventional. This can unleash your inner creativity and lead to unexpected yet exciting outcomes.
4. Collaborate with Others: Working with others can provide new perspectives. Introduce brainstorming sessions with fellow creatives or friends, and leverage their insights to overcome your creative challenges.
5. Limit Your Choices: Paradoxically, having too many options can lead to overwhelm. Set limitations on your design choices, whether in colors, shapes, or tools. This constraint can enhance focus and streamline your creative process.
Quick Design Software Hacks for Instant Inspiration
When you're feeling tapped out creatively, design software hacks can provide the instant inspiration you need. Start by exploring the built-in templates available in your preferred design programs. Most modern design tools come with a variety of customizable templates that can kickstart your project. Additionally, consider utilizing keyboard shortcuts to streamline your workflow—this can not only save time but also free up mental energy for new ideas. Remember to take a break and allow your subconscious to work; sometimes the best inspiration strikes when you're away from the screen.
Another quick hack is to browse through online design communities and forums. Sites like Behance or Dribbble are treasure troves of design inspiration. Take a moment to search for projects in your niche and reflect on what stands out to you. You can also create a mood board by compiling colors, images, and design elements that resonate with your vision; this tactile approach can help clarify your aesthetic direction. Lastly, don’t underestimate the power of color palettes. Use tools like Adobe Color to generate harmonious color schemes that can ignite your creativity and offer new perspectives on your designs.
What to Do When Creativity Hits a Wall: Fast Solutions
Experiencing a creative block can be incredibly frustrating, but it's essential to recognize that it's a common hurdle for many. When creativity hits a wall, the first step is to change your environment. A simple adjustment, like moving to a different room or going for a walk in nature, can stimulate your mind and yield fresh ideas. You might also consider engaging in a brief physical activity, as exercise releases endorphins that can enhance your mood and creativity.
Another effective strategy is to embrace the concept of free writing. Set a timer for 10-15 minutes, and write continuously about any subject that comes to mind, without worrying about grammar or structure. This technique can help you clear your mind of distractions and unlock buried thoughts. To further boost your creativity, try surrounding yourself with inspiring materials—whether that's a mood board of visual art or a playlist of motivational music. These tools can ignite your imagination and help you push through that wall.
